Fire damage repair services involve assessing and restoring properties affected by fires, including the removal of soot, smoke residues, and charred materials. Professionals typically begin with a thorough inspection to determine the extent of damage, followed by cleaning and debris removal. Restoration may include repairing structural components, replacing damaged drywall, flooring, and other building materials, and addressing lingering odors caused by smoke. The goal is to return the property to a safe and habitable condition, minimizing the long-term impact of fire and smoke damage.
These services help address a variety of problems resulting from fire incidents, such as structural instability, smoke odors, and water damage from firefighting efforts. Fire damage can weaken the integrity of a building’s framework, making it unsafe for occupancy. Smoke and soot residues can cause ongoing health issues and staining, while water used during firefighting can lead to mold growth if not properly managed. Fire damage repair specialists work to mitigate these issues, restoring the property’s safety, appearance, and structural soundness.

Assessment and Inspection Costs - Initial fire damage assessments typically range from $200 to $1,000, depending on the size of the affected area. This includes evaluating the extent of damage and determining necessary repairs. Additional inspections may increase costs accordingly.
Structural Repair Expenses - Restoring damaged structures can cost between $5,000 and $30,000 or more. Factors influencing price include the extent of fire and smoke damage, with larger projects requiring more extensive work.
Cleaning and Odor Removal - Professional cleaning services for fire and smoke odor removal usually range from $300 to $2,500. The cost varies based on the severity of odor and the size of the affected space.
Contents Restoration Costs - Restoring or replacing fire-damaged belongings typically costs between $500 and $10,000. This includes cleaning, deodorizing, and repairing personal items and furniture affected by the fire.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
